Job Title: Industrial Automation and Robotics Engineer
Job Location: Hornell, NY
Job Type: Full Time
Rate of Pay: $103,230/year to $113,553/year
Duties: Support the Automation & Robotic Leader in new robotic cell integration. Identify and propose process optimizations and improvements to robotic assets. Responsible for putting robotic cells into operation. During specification and preliminary design phases, gather and define maintenance requirements in equipment specifications. Define maintenance strategy for future equipment. Prepare equipment installation and coordinate all stakeholders. During detailed design phase and manufacturing activity, develop specifications of industrial means for serial production. Complete maintenance documentation including WKI, spare part list, and criticality matrix. Manage supplier and contractor for maintenance activity. Monitor equipment performance, and define and animate roadmap for improvements. Define technical specifications for new installations and new machine functionalities. Conduct functional analysis of installation and provide integrator support. Define upgrades on existing equipment including for process improvement and mitigation of machine weaknesses, etc. Modify and qualify new robotic programs based on production need projected from dry runs and offline simulations. Participate in design review for new robotic project installations, as well as in machine acceptance testing and all functionality tests. Adjust machine settings, calibrate cells, and create simulations of new 3D cells. Responsible for development and implementation of robotics automation on-site, including TS, P-FMEA, design review, offline checks, and TPT for robot scope calculation. Validate with supplier on tooling concept, and validate 3D models. Generate robotic work instruction for machine operation and safety. Accompany manufacturing team in production ramp-up. Participate in process qualification for welding, sanding, shotblasting, painting, etc. Work with Jigs-Tools department to verify accessibility and kinematics of Robot operation. Support maintenance team in troubleshooting.
10% domestic & 10% international travel required. May work at various unanticipated locations throughout U.S.
Requirements: Employer will accept a Bachelor's degree in Mechanical, Electrical, or Automation Engineering or related field and 6 years of experience in the job offered or in an Industrial Automation and Robotics Engineer-related occupation.
